The Pistons started off the night in a funk, tied them at halftime, went ahead by five only to play the long ball for the balance of the third quarter and lose going away....

Got outrebounded a bunch because Flip went with Dice who managed 4 points and 1 rebound. Brahma was 4-4 shooting but only played 10 minutes. Naz was a no show as Flip had him nailed to the bench too. We can always blame this on the players for taking to many ill advised shots from the perimeter, but why didn't Flip just yank the staters and put in the bench?? In additon to MAX 4-4, Murray hit his last five shots, but our front court of Dice, Tay, and Wallace go a combined 5-26 shooting and 19 rebounds with 15 of those grabbed by Sheed.

If Flip comes back from this trip with no wins, he deserves to be fired All of these games were winnable even without nameless Ben!!

Too many 3 attempts when they were still in the game. I can appreciate the two treys that Delfino made, but can you check to see if there is an open man in or near the paint and feed him before tossing up a unconsious three@##$

The defense on Kevin Martin was horrible as the Pistons appeared that they had never seen him before constantly leaving him open for some uncontested jumpers...

There was an Alternatorz sighting as both Jon Barry and Corliss were in the building, but unfortunately for the Pistons one was burning them on the Mic and the other was burning them to the tune of 15 points in the paint, clearly out playing Dice. The sight of Joe Dumars sitting there must have got McNasty inspired..."take that Joe"

what was more annoying than anything about this game is that we didn't show up. at least for utah i thought we showed up and got jobbed by the refs. but this was our laziest game of the year, and it's not like it was a back-to-back.

i was also annoyed at flip playing so much small ball. yes our big men were somewhat ineffective, and he did try a big lineup at one point (with delfino at the 2 spot), but he said he was going to force teams to match up with us this year and not the other way around. well, we played small ball, and that's exactly what sacramento is good at.

after chauncey hit his 4th three-pointer and we were on a roll, a timeout was called, and i got worried. last year when we were draining 3s, we got LAZY and stopped running our offense. coming back from the timeout, that's exactly what happened. chauncey dribbling at the top of the key for 12 seconds, one pass, and one shot. it was stupid, and apparently contagious. two of delfino's five 3-ppoint attempts were terrible.

i really see joe d. looking at front-court changes if this inconsistency continues. but either way, this was a terrible effort and annoying to watch. you knew by the start of the 4th that we weren't winning this game.
